From 4a3dbb926ae3f5410198d7cc4f4ebe4f62eebf05 Mon Sep 17 00:00:00 2001 From: marha Date: Sat, 25 Jul 2009 19:39:46 +0000 Subject: Added xorg-server-1.6.2.tar.gz --- xorg-server/include/cursor.h | 13 ++++++++++--- 1 file changed, 10 insertions(+), 3 deletions(-) (limited to 'xorg-server/include/cursor.h') diff --git a/xorg-server/include/cursor.h b/xorg-server/include/cursor.h index 8635cf1a2..f7c16e3f9 100644 --- a/xorg-server/include/cursor.h +++ b/xorg-server/include/cursor.h @@ -59,9 +59,14 @@ SOFTWARE. #define ARGB_CURSOR #endif +struct _DeviceIntRec; + typedef struct _Cursor *CursorPtr; typedef struct _CursorMetric *CursorMetricPtr; +extern int cursorScreenDevPriv[MAXSCREENS]; +#define CursorScreenKey(pScreen) (cursorScreenDevPriv + (pScreen)->myNum) + extern CursorPtr rootCursor; extern int FreeCursor( @@ -105,7 +110,7 @@ extern CursorPtr CreateRootCursor( extern int ServerBitsFromGlyph( FontPtr /*pfont*/, unsigned int /*ch*/, - register CursorMetricPtr /*cm*/, + CursorMetricPtr /*cm*/, unsigned char ** /*ppbits*/); extern Bool CursorMetricsFromGlyph( @@ -117,18 +122,20 @@ extern void CheckCursorConfinement( WindowPtr /*pWin*/); extern void NewCurrentScreen( + struct _DeviceIntRec* /*pDev*/, ScreenPtr /*newScreen*/, int /*x*/, int /*y*/); -extern Bool PointerConfinedToScreen(void); +extern Bool PointerConfinedToScreen(struct _DeviceIntRec* /* pDev */); extern void GetSpritePosition( + struct _DeviceIntRec* /* pDev */, int * /*px*/, int * /*py*/); #ifdef PANORAMIX -extern int XineramaGetCursorScreen(void); +extern int XineramaGetCursorScreen(struct _DeviceIntRec* pDev); #endif /* PANORAMIX */ #endif /* CURSOR_H */ -- cgit v1.2.3